WebOutput 1. Enter a number: 25 [1] "25 is not a prime number". Output 2. Enter a number: 19 [1] "19 is a prime number". Here, we take an integer from the user and check whether it is prime or not. Numbers less than or equal to 1 are not prime numbers. Hence, we only proceed if the num is greater than 1. We check if num is exactly divisible by any ...
